Subject: [rt-tests v2 v2 07/20] signaltest: Always use libnuma

libnuma is hard dependency for signaltest. Thus we can always call
numa_initialize(). This allows us to remove the global 'numa' variable
to track if libnuma has been initialized or not.

 src/signaltest/signaltest.c | 10 ++++------
 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

diff --git a/src/signaltest/signaltest.c b/src/signaltest/signaltest.c
index 918d2ab98f6e..b3a82f8c4f65 100644
--- a/src/signaltest/signaltest.c
+++ b/src/signaltest/signaltest.c
@@ -206,7 +206,6 @@ static int quiet;
 static int lockall;
 static struct bitmask *affinity_mask = NULL;
 static int smp = 0;
-static int numa = 0;
 static int setaffinity = AFFINITY_UNSPECIFIED;
 
 /* Process commandline options */
@@ -214,6 +213,7 @@ static void process_options(int argc, char *argv[], unsigned int max_cpus)
 {
 	int option_affinity = 0;
 	int error = 0;
+	int numa = 0;
 
 	for (;;) {
 		int option_index = 0;
@@ -242,8 +242,6 @@ static void process_options(int argc, char *argv[], unsigned int max_cpus)
 			/* smp sets AFFINITY_USEALL in OPT_SMP */
 			if (smp)
 				break;
-			if (numa_initialize())
-				fatal("Couldn't initialize libnuma");
 			numa = 1;
 			if (optarg) {
 				parse_cpumask(optarg, max_cpus, &affinity_mask);
@@ -298,9 +296,6 @@ static void process_options(int argc, char *argv[], unsigned int max_cpus)
 
 	/* if smp wasn't requested, test for numa automatically */
 	if (!smp) {
-		if (numa_initialize())
-			fatal("Couldn't initialize libnuma");
-		numa = 1;
 		if (setaffinity == AFFINITY_UNSPECIFIED)
 			setaffinity = AFFINITY_USEALL;
 	}
@@ -354,6 +349,9 @@ int main(int argc, char **argv)
 	int status, cpu;
 	int max_cpus = sysconf(_SC_NPROCESSORS_ONLN);
 
+	if (numa_initialize())
+		fatal("Couldn't initialize libnuma");
+
 	process_options(argc, argv, max_cpus);
 
 	if (check_privs())
